Texas Instruments TLC274CDR Precision Op Amp
The Texas Instruments TLC274CDR is a high-performance, precision operational amplifier that offers a blend of flexibility and reliability for a wide range of applications. This quad operational amplifier is designed with advanced LinCMOS technology, providing a significant improvement in speed and input bias over traditional CMOS amplifiers.
Key Features:
- Low Power Consumption: The TLC274CDR is optimized for low power consumption, making it an ideal choice for battery-powered and portable applications where power efficiency is critical.
- Wide Supply Range: It operates over a wide supply range of 4 V to 16 V on a single supply or ±2 V to ±8 V on dual supplies, providing flexibility in various circuit configurations.
- High Input Impedance: With a high input impedance, this op-amp minimizes the loading effect on input sources and preserves signal integrity.
- Low Input Bias and Offset Currents: The TLC274CDR ensures accurate signal amplification with minimal deviation due to its low input bias and offset currents.
- Output Short-Circuit Protection: Enhanced safety is provided with the built-in output short-circuit protection, which guards the device against potential damage due to output faults.

Product Specifications:
The TLC274CDR comes in a 14-pin SOIC package and is characterized for operation from 0°C to 70°C. It is also RoHS compliant, adhering to environmental standards.
